She played Karen Walker in the NBC comedy Will & Grace (1998)-2006, 2017, 2020). As a result of her performance, she was nominated for 8 Primetime Emmy Awards in the category of Outstanding Supporting Actress in a Comedy Series. In 2000 and 2006, she was awarded twice. Her character also received nominations to a variety of other honors, including seven consecutive Screen Actors Guild Awards for Outstanding Performance of a Female Actor in a Comedy Series. She won three occasions between 2001 between 2001 and 2002. Her first acting credits included the role in a McDonald's commercial starring John Goodman. Her debut came on The Ellen Burstyn Show, which aired on the air in 1986. She subsequently guest starred in sitcoms including Seinfeld Frasier Wings Ned and Stacey Mad About You Caroline in the City 3rd Rock from the Sun as well as Just Shoot Me!. The character she played was the main one in episode five of season 5 of Murder She Wrote. Her parents are Martha Mullally and Carter Mullally Jr. Mullally was six years old when she relocated from Los Angeles to Oklahoma City in Oklahoma where her father was born. Her parents are of English Irish descent and Scandinavian origins. Since the age of 6 she's been studying ballet. She danced with The Oklahoma City Ballet and also attended an academy called the School of American Ballet, New York City during her college years.
